        This is a book show. Read and enjoy them in your free time! Let's do pleasure reading together.

    The Third Wheel

        Greg Heffley is at school. His middle school is going to hold a dance party, but it is very difficult for Greg to find anyone to go with. Finally he finds a girl from his class luckily. That is the beginning of The Third Wheel's story. This book is full of jokes and interesting pictures.

    By Jeff Kinney

    Ivy and Bean

         Bean's older sister goes to a summer camp, but Bean can't join her because she is too young. So Bean and her best friend, Ivy, decide to create their own camp. They come up with all the activities and, of course, they make the rules. Their happiness and kindness will make you want to keep reading.

    By Annie Barrows

    Stick Dog

         Stick Dog is a dog that lives in an empty pipe(管子). He has four friends named Poo-Poo, Stripes, Karen and Mutt. When Stick Dog smells delicious hamburgers, he and his friends decide to steal the food from a human family that is having a picnic in Picasso Park. Along the way, they face a lot of funny challenges.

    By Tom Watson

    White Fur Flying

         Zoe and Alice's mother saves dogs! But dogs aren't the only things that need to be saved. The family's new neighbour, Phillip, doesn't speak, and no one knows why. White, Fur Flying is all about understanding the love from both inside and outside. Although it is a little sad, the book is good to read.

    By Patricia MacLachlan
